Full Job Description
Job Description

SUMMARY:
Associate Development at Marriott is positioned to fuel performance, enrich lives, and accelerate reinvention. It is an integral function that directly impacts and supports business performance and drives the organization's people priorities around growing great leaders, investing in our associates, and ensuring access to opportunity. The Senior Director, Associate Development Technology Strategies & Solutions role provides the opportunity to drive tremendous change and create meaningful and lasting impact given the following accountabilities:

  • Partner across the Associate Development team at HQ and in continent to drive solutioning for both the business and learners, maximizing the capabilities of our current tools


  • Shape & execute upon a learning technology strategy & roadmap inclusive of AI and where the space is going as the pace of technology changes continues to accelerate


  • Lead with a product mindset, putting the end user at the center


  • Ensure the voice of the learner and needs of the business directly shape the associate development digital solutions we use - this includes the learning experience platform, cohort learning technology, in- tool/performance support, and other digital learning solutions


  • Strengthen and champion the innovation muscle within the associate development COE through tech whether it be the actual tech used, digital learning modalities leveraged and digital delivery mechanisms to reach our learners


  • In partnership with internal technology partners, identify capability gaps and emerging needs to then influence our providers and their product roadmaps such that we may level up our learning strategy through technology


This position will partner with colleagues in other teams who also have critical responsibility for driving the following aspects of ensuring a solid learning tech stack and ultimately, creating a great learner experience. Partnership and stellar communication will be key as it relates to the following - which are led by colleagues in other teams:

  • Learning Administration: Implementations of learning programs and content are completed by the Design & Development team


  • Feature/Release Management: While vendor relationships are critical for this role and it will influence/shape specific product features within the ecosystem, care and feeding for releases is ultimately managed by the technology organization


  • Technology Integrations: Systems and data flawlessly integrating between one another is managed by our technology organization


  • Learner Support: Flawless system support and issue management/escalation is cared for by our HR delivery team and technology partners. This role may however evaluate service and issues at a thematic level to then translate them into enhancements and product upgrades as appropriate.


SPECIFIC RESPONSIBILITIES:

Solutioning:

  • For annual strategic planning and on an initiative or project-by-project basis, translate business priorities into learning solutions powered through tech. Partner with the Performance Advisors, learning design/development leads, and continent learning teams to meet specific learner/business needs through maximized utilization of current learning tech and its specific features while also staying on top of where the space is heading, gaps, and future tech investments that may be neededWith a strong grounding in the current capabilities of our tech stack, influence learning strategies and drive impactful learning solutions through thoughtful and creative application of our tech.


  • Work with Associate Development colleagues to develop and drive use cases and adoption for new ways of learning. Combine science-driven learning with voice of the learner and business to result in useful, innovative tech-enabled experiences for our learners. Partner with deployment and continent learning teams to evaluate and drive adoption of new ways of learning and utilization of solutions.


  • In all solutioning related efforts, maximize our current tools to meet business/learner needs. Where required, develop high-level business requirements. Work closely with internal technology teams as they translate business requirements into technical requirements and work with our vendor partners through design phases. Prior to any launches, serve as voice of the Associate Development COE/learners/business stakeholders and validate that expected business outcomes are being met.


Voice of the Learner & Business:

  • Ensure voice of the learner and needs of the business are represented in our HR technology strategy, technology stack and vendor roadmaps both near and long term. Partner with Associate Development colleagues and business stakeholders in order to conduct comprehensive, deeply insightful needs analysis so that we continually ensure learner and business needs are understood and capability gaps are identified.


  • In caring for the voice of the learner and the business, identify capability gaps (e.g. features) and work with internal technology partners to ensure capability requests are understood and prioritized with a focus on highest impact/highest priority needs are being addressed.


  • Drive a continual feedback loop back to stakeholders representing learners and the business to communicate how capabilities are or will be met.


Roadmap, Strategy + Impact:

  • Create a comprehensive Global Associate Development innovation strategy and roadmap inclusive of AI; gain buy-in from stakeholders and team members to shape, drive adoption of and evolve the strategy.


  • Keep the ADinnovation strategy ahead of the curve; continually assess the value and impact of new learning technologies, tools, and systems and serve as an evangelist for driving business and learner impact through tech. Drive a culture of benchmarking, researching the market and identifying learning trends that are relevant to Marriott in providing best-in-class learning experience. Care for the measurement + impact studies of our learning tools, programs, and solutions.


  • Manage the pull-through of our strategy into our ecosystem of digital learning solutions and modalities used to reach learners. In partnership with our internal technology teams, care for the strategic relationship management of current learning technology providers. Facilitate a strong partnership by driving business reviews and working to align priorities and roadmaps. Convey business/learner priorities and capability needs.


OUR EDUCATION + E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ENTS

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ree, ideally in business, education, digital technology, user experience or a relevant discipline that provides a solid grounding on human behaviors and motivations


  • Ten or more years of experience that includes learning strategy, innovation, strategy/solutions, or digital product management


This leader must:

  • Be culturally aware, process-oriented with structured problem-solving skills, and an ability to work cross-functionally


  • Have a consultative touch in the way they work - be an excellent listener, distill insights into action, and exercise creativity to meet stakeholder/user needs


  • Have a bias for action and execution while maintaining a strategic mindset towards the future


  • Be able to juggle multiple and shifting priorities while landing planes in a complex, global, matrixed environment

About Marriott International

Marriott International is a hospitality company with more than 3,900 properties around the world. Marriot International opened its first hotel in 1957 and operates franchises worldwide. The company’s headquarters is based in Maryland and employees nearly 200,000 people worldwide.   The company was founded by J. Willard and Alice Marriott in 1927 by opening a root beer stand in Washington D.C.
